In August of 2008, Nate released his first professionally recorded EP, "Songs From the Shade". In the spirit of Jack Johnson, "Songs" is a simple, acoustic project with an emphasis on harmony. Nate sets himself apart from the mainstream by pulling his lyrics from real life experiences, and then relating these experiences to issues that actually matter. Songs about love and justice make up the bulk of his content, and everything orbits around the desire for an abundant life, a life that is more than merely living and breathing, paired with a deep disgust for apathy and complacency.
Nate's live shows range from solo performances to full band concerts rounded out by guitars and djembe. During his live show, he has no trouble connecting with his audience. In Nate's own words, "I try to be really honest and genuine and because of this, the music deals with topics and issues that many are not willing to touch on or write about. The music isn’t loud and it doesn’t overshadow the lyrics. The music does not solely ride on a ‘catchy tune’, but I try to really say something worthwhile and convicting. Anyone can sing a melody, but I try to focus on harmony as much as possible because that’s what gives me chills when I listen to music and I want to effect people that way as well."
Nate's desire is to write music that inspires people to act, whether that action is supporting his music or general philanthropy. In Nate Hale's song Real Love, the singer questions what it means to truly love someone and ponders the emptiness of a love that is based solely on pleasure. The singer mentions feeling something that other people call love and acknowledges the pleasure that comes with it, but asserts that there must be more to love than just pleasure. The singer believes that something is wrong with the way love is typically defined and can feel the pain of this realization in their soul. The singer decides that they will not be a hypocrite by continuing a love that they know is hollow and meaningless, and instead seeks to redefine their understanding of love, dating, and relationships.
Throughout the song, the singer emphasizes the importance of true beauty, modesty, and purity, rejecting the notion that beauty is only found in high heels, makeup, and lipstick. The singer insists that there must be more to love than this shallow understanding of beauty and that true love requires us to get a better grip on what it means to love and be loved. Ultimately, the singer wants to do the right thing and truly understand the meaning of love before moving forward.
